Worcester Sunday Netball Updated 22nd March

Week 9 of the Worcester Sunday Netball saw another round of well-contested matches, with teams continuing to show effort and improvement across the board.

On The Attack delivered a strong performance against Cobras, coming away with a 19–4 win. Their organised defence and consistent shooting helped them maintain control, while Cobras continued to work hard throughout the game.

Toxic Goals also had a solid outing, securing a 15–4 victory over Rebounders. Rebounders showed determination, but Toxic Goals’ steady passing and finishing made the difference on the day.

Seven Wonders faced Spice Goals in a competitive match, with Seven Wonders earning a 14–4 win. Their teamwork and consistency on court helped them build momentum as the game progressed.

This week’s Most Valued Player was Jenni Luke from Spice Goals, recognised for her all-round contribution and positive impact during the match.
